General Motors (GM) enters binding long-term supply agreement with Vacuumschmelze
January 30, 2023 8:37 AM ESTVacuumschmelze (VAC) announced Monday that the advanced magnetic materials company has entered into a binding long-term supply agreement with General Motors (NYSE: GM). GM to downgraded to Hold as Berenberg awaits better entry point
January 30, 2023 7:36 AM ESTBerenberg downgraded General Motors (NYSE: GM) to a Hold rating (From Buy) and cut the price target on the stock to $41.00 (From $45.00) as analyst Adrian Yanoshik believes the American auto maker will continue to face near-term challenges from mass-market affordability and cost inflation. Morgan Stanley Bullish as Tesla (TSLA) ushers in the 'Great EV Deflation'
January 27, 2023 11:55 AM ESTMorgan Stanley reiterated an Outperform rating and $220.00 price target on Tesla (NASDAQ: TSLA) as the electric vehicle giants recent price cuts usher in, what analyst Adam Jonas calls, the Great EV Deflation.
Jonas wrote in a note, In recent days, Ive asked several dealers and automotive experts if theyve ever seen a car company cut prices by 13 to 20% across the vast majority of its product range in one move. Nobody can think of a precedent.
